Wales Chartism and church failings provoke unrest

A Welsh unrest report describes Chartist influence in Bedwelly and Mynyddalwyn as linked to religious neglect with churches poorly placed and underused. It notes leaders from local dissenting ministers and calls for new churches and proper education, while detailing prison examinations, arrests for high treason and sedition, and military mobilization around Pontypool and Merthyr.

Chartist Riots and Trials at Tredegar Court

In Tredegar a rioting case unfolds with prisoners Bowen and Thomas remanded after disputed statements about age and wages. Witnesses describe Chartist activity, a gun found, and a loud confrontation as special constables recount encounters with protesters and wounded Lowell. The magistrates discharge one defendant as the court adjourns to next morning.

Reduction in Postage by Weight and Penny Rate Plan

The document outlines a Treasury minute dated Nov 12 1839 detailing steps to introduce postage by weight and a uniform penny rate. It explains phased implementation, anticipated public convenience, and safeguards to minimize disruption, with specific weight-based charges and regional adjustments for inland, foreign, and ship letters.
